Can immersive storytelling be used to create greater insight and influence people more powerfully than traditional film? Maria Herholdt Engermann from the Danish VR studio Mannd (whose work What We Eat will be shown at the festival), Emma Bexell from the performance group Bombina Bombast (current with Kinematografi Cinematography – a VR version of Ingmar Bergman’s Persona) and Ove Rishøj Jensen from Autoimages (producer for the VR prototype The Moment of Freedom Experience) meet in a dialog about influence and engrossment. Is it easy to go from film to VR and can you use similar tools? We also take a closer look at what the business model for virtual reality looks like. Moderator: Hanna Schedin Carter, BoostHbg. Sound engineer: Andre Laos Produced for K-play by Kulturakademin In cooperation with Kultur i Väst, Narrative VR Lab and BoostHbg under Göteborg Film Festival 2019. www.kulturakademin.com
